from __future__ import annotations
import os
import sys
from datetime import datetime
from typing import Any, Final, List, Optional, Tuple
import requests
# --- Configuration (Strongly Typed Constants) ---
REPO_OWNER: Final[str] = "Karnikhil90"
REPO_NAME: Final[str] = "NHostAPI"
BRANCH: Final[str] = "master"
# API Endpoints
TREE_API_URL: Final[str] = (
f"https://api.github.com/repos/{REPO_OWNER}/{REPO_NAME}/git/trees/{BRANCH}?recursive=1"
)
RAW_BASE_URL: Final[str] = (
f"https://raw.githubusercontent.com/{REPO_OWNER}/{REPO_NAME}/{BRANCH}"
)
VERSION_FILE_NAME: Final[str] = "version.txt"
# Local Paths
LOG_DIR: Final[str] = ".logs"
LOG_FILE: Final[str] = os.path.join(LOG_DIR, "update.log")
TIME_FORMAT: Final[str] = "%Y-%m-%dT%H:%M:%S"
def _now_iso() -> str:
"""Return current time in ISO-8601 format."""
return datetime.now().strftime(TIME_FORMAT)
def log_update(message: str) -> None:
"""Log message with ISO timestamp and print to stdout."""
os.makedirs(LOG_DIR, exist_ok=True)
line: str = f"[{_now_iso()}] = {message}"
with open(LOG_FILE, "a", encoding="utf-8") as f:
f.write(line + "\n")
print(line)
def get_remote_version() -> str:
"""Fetch the version string from GitHub with error handling."""
url: str = f"{RAW_BASE_URL}/{VERSION_FILE_NAME}"
response: requests.Response = requests.get(url, timeout=10)
response.raise_for_status()
return response.text.strip()
def get_local_version() -> Optional[str]:
"""Safely read the local version file if it exists."""
if not os.path.exists(VERSION_FILE_NAME):
return None
try:
with open(VERSION_FILE_NAME, "r", encoding="utf-8") as f:
return f.read().strip()
except OSError:
return None
def download_file(relative_path: str, raw_url: str) -> None:
"""
Downloads a file using a 'Atomic Write' strategy:
1. Create directory structure.
2. Download to a .tmp file.
3. Rename .tmp to actual filename (prevents corruption on crash).
"""
temp_path: str = f"{relative_path}.tmp"
# Ensure directory exists
dir_name: str = os.path.dirname(relative_path)
if dir_name:
os.makedirs(dir_name, exist_ok=True)
response: requests.Response = requests.get(raw_url, timeout=15, stream=True)
response.raise_for_status()
# Write binary (prevents line-ending issues across Windows/Linux)
with open(temp_path, "wb") as f:
for chunk in response.iter_content(chunk_size=8192):
f.write(chunk)
# Atomic swap: replace old file with new one
if os.path.exists(relative_path):
os.remove(relative_path)
os.rename(temp_path, relative_path)
def perform_full_update() -> None:
"""Orchestrates the discovery and download of all repo files."""
log_update("Syncing file structure with GitHub...")
response: requests.Response = requests.get(TREE_API_URL, timeout=10)
response.raise_for_status()
# Parse the Git Tree
tree: List[dict[str, Any]] = response.json().get("tree", [])
# Filter for files (blobs) and exclude hidden git files if any
files_to_update: List[str] = [
item["path"] for item in tree if item["type"] == "blob"
]
for file_path in files_to_update:
raw_url: str = f"{RAW_BASE_URL}/{file_path}"
log_update(f"Synchronizing: {file_path}")
download_file(file_path, raw_url)
def main() -> None:
"""Main execution block with strict error boundaries."""
try:
log_update("Initializing update check...")
remote_v: str = get_remote_version()
local_v: Optional[str] = get_local_version()
if local_v is None:
log_update("Fresh installation detected. Downloading all files...")
perform_full_update()
log_update(f"Successfully installed version {remote_v}")
elif remote_v != local_v:
log_update(f"Upgrade available: {local_v} -> {remote_v}")
perform_full_update()
log_update("Update completed successfully.")
else:
log_update(f"System is up to date (v{local_v}).")
except requests.RequestException as e:
log_update(f"Network Level Error: {e}")
sys.exit(1)
except Exception as e:
log_update(f"Critical System Error: {e}")
sys.exit(1)
if __name__ == "__main__":
main()
